England pacer Gus Atkinson in doubt for 1st Test against India

England pacer Gus Atkinson, as per reports, remains in doubt for the first Test match against India beginning June 20 at Leeds due to a hamstring injury. India and England will play a five-match Test series against each other over the next two months. 

“Gus Atkinson is a doubt for the first Test against India later this month because of a right hamstring strain - adding to England’s injury concerns among their seamers,” a report in BBC read.

Atkinson picked up the injury during the one-off Test against Zimbabwe last month, which also put him on the sidelines from the recently concluded three-match ODI series against West Indies. Atkinson has claimed three five-wicket hauls in his 12 Tests and has been a major figure in England's bowling department. His injury, meanwhile, poses a serious threat to England’s bowling unit, which is already reeling from the injuries to Mark Wood and Olly Stone.
